35-14-1301 . Definitions -- appraisal rights. For the purposes of this part, the following definitions apply:

(1)"Affiliate" means a person that directly, or indirectly through one or more intermediaries controls, is controlled by or is under common control with another person or is a senior executive of another person. For purposes of 35-14-1302 (2)(d), a person is considered an affiliate of its senior executives.
(2)"Beneficial owner" means any person who directly, or indirectly through any contract, arrangement, or understanding, other than a revocable proxy, has or shares the power to vote or to direct the voting of shares.
